Background
Harvey Weinstein, the former Hollywood mogul, is back in the spotlight as he faces a retrial in New York for alleged sex crimes. This retrial comes after his initial conviction in 2020, which marked a significant moment in the #MeToo movement.
Key Details of the Retrial
- Charges: Weinstein is facing multiple charges, including sexual assault and rape, involving several women.
- Legal Proceedings: The retrial is expected to revisit testimonies and evidence from the original trial, with potential new witnesses.
- Defense Strategy: Weinstein’s legal team is anticipated to challenge the credibility of the accusers and the evidence presented.
